A Two-Hour Tour That Changes Scenes Fast

Great River Bamboo Rafting & hipstrip Tour - A Two-Hour Tour That Changes Scenes Fast
This is the kind of excursion you book when you want action without turning your whole day into logistics. In roughly 2 hours, you go from a city-view and shopping window to a beach-and-nightlife zone, then finish with bamboo rafting along the river at Lethe.

Why that matters: you get variety without committing to a long tour schedule. If you’re stopping in Montego Bay for a short stay, or you’ve already got one big tour planned, this gives you a second storyline to remember. It’s also a private tour/activity, which usually makes the drive feel smoother and the timing easier to manage for your group.

The one thing to watch is your expectations. This isn’t a slow, sit-on-the-veranda style outing. It’s a compact route with set time blocks, so the win is convenience and energy, not deep, lingering exploration.

Lethe Bamboo Rafting: The 1-Hour Main Event

Great River Bamboo Rafting & hipstrip Tour - Lethe Bamboo Rafting: The 1-Hour Main Event
Then comes the reason many people book this tour: bamboo rafting in Lethe. You spend about 1 hour here in a lush, quiet, relaxing river setting.

The value of choosing rafting on a schedule like this is that you don’t lose the day to a long drive or multiple activity changes. You get a clear “main course” block. The rest is built around it.

The rafting portion has admission listed as free, which helps keep the total cost sensible. Also, because most travelers can participate, it’s set up for a broad range of visitors. Still, I’d treat it as an active water outing. Wear something you don’t mind getting damp, and plan for the fact that you’ll be doing at least some moving around as you go from transport to the river area and back.

What I like about finishing with Lethe: it’s a calmer wind-down compared to city energy. You’ve got city and entertainment up front, then you end in a more nature-focused moment—useful if you’re trying to balance your vacation between “busy fun” and “quiet reset.”
